About the role

In this role you will join the Search Engine Marketing (SEM) bidding team, who own and manage the data-led systems that ensure we’re making the most out of our paid search advertising spend. Your contribution will have a direct impact on paid search bidding strategies, optimizing existing automated systems and using data to help identify new opportunities or problem areas in paid search marketing. You will work in collaboration with the wider SEM team, Data Science and Data Engineering teams to actively measure and manage the performance and optimization of our paid search program across UK & FIGS markets. Furthermore, you will help the team adopt AI. This means finding real-world applications for AI tools to make our systems run faster, improve the quality of our data analysis and uncover deeper analytical insights.

What You’ll Do

  • Produce original analyses to identify and explore opportunities to optimize our search engine marketing (SEM) bidding strategies towards maximizing revenue.
  • Seek out and implement improvements to our existing automated paid marketing systems.
  • Plan and execute measurement tests and experiments to evaluate the impact of different bidding strategies and apply findings to improve performance.
  • Apply analytical techniques to measure the true return of our SEM spend.
  • Collaborate closely with cross-functional teams such as Marketing and Data Science/Machine Learning to align on strategies, share insights, and ensure objectives are met.
  • Check on marketing performance daily and regularly report outward to the wider team and upward to the leadership team about trends, wins, and future plans.
  • Leverage AI tools and technologies for day-to-day tasks & systems to enhance efficiency, generate insights and streamline workflows.
  • Stay informed and proactively implement emerging ad technologies, best practices in media systems management and bidding optimization, process improvements and automation to enhance performance.
